**Changed defaults: idempotency keys on payment retries**

As of this release, idempotency keys are generated automatically for every retry attempt rather than only when the merchant supplies one. This closes the duplicate-charge gap support has been triaging since the spring. Merchants who previously passed their own keys are unaffected; ours only fill the blanks. Retry windows and backoff caps were also tightened to match the new behavior. When walking a merchant through a dispute, reference the current defaults below:

service settings:
PRAIX_LOG_LEVEL=error
PRAIX_METRICS_HOST=metrics.praix.qorvelcorp.corp
PRAIX_POOL_SIZE=16

## Deployment

Quick heads-up for anyone shipping Reportloom: the report builder relies on stable sorting so grouped rows don't shuffle between runs. We pin the sort backend in config rather than trusting runtime defaults, because the Kestrelwood cluster once swapped libraries mid-release and customer exports reordered overnight. Always deploy with the stable-sort flag set and verify a sample export afterward. These are the config values the deploy job reads:

deployment values, yadug-bawif:
[framir]
team = pelox
access_code = ac_a38ab2
owner = tamion.julael
host = framir.tolvaqlabs.test
port = 11211
peer = tammir.zemvargrid.local
salt = 2215ef03
pin = 1541

This PR turns on websocket compression for the Quillbridge relay tier. Compression reduces egress roughly 40% on chatty channels but opens a CRIME-style oracle if attacker-controlled bytes share a context window with secrets. Mitigation: per-message context reset on authenticated frames, compression disabled entirely for token-bearing channels, and a hard cap on window bits to bound memory per connection. CPU cost measured at ~6% on the Fenwick staging cluster. Security review should focus on the constants below.

tuning table, faduf-baduf:
PRIORITIES = {
    "ulavan": 191,
    "silys": 750,
    "goriel": 238,
    "kelmir": 66,
    "wendor": 432,
}